Small Towns/Big Trends: Demographic Insights on Living, Working and Thriving in Rural America–Carsey School Senior Demographer Ken Johnson – along with Carsey Fellows Shannon Monnat and Leif Jenson and Carsey Author/UNH Alum Jessica Ulrich-Schad – participated in a congressional briefing last week on demographic trends in rural America. The presenters discussed research outcomes addressing contemporary issues impacting rural America, including COVID-19, economic mobility, mortality, aging, climate change, and natural impacts of population growth.
